Act No. 206/2017 Coll. introduced a definition of covered agency employment into the Employment Act and enshrined it as an activity of a legal or natural person consisting in hiring labour to another legal or natural person without complying with the conditions for employment mediation under Section 1 4(1)(b) of the Employment Act. In other words, a legal or natural person illegally provides labour to another entity, i.e. there is an intermediation of employment of natural persons for the purpose of performing their work for this other entity (the so-called user), which is understood as another legal or natural person who assigns the work and supervises its performance.
